Buying from Tiger direct is definitely not good...they have horrible customer service (or lack thereof), and that's just the start of things. You would want to go with PCI-E - it'll be cheaper...honestly, you are going to be hard pressed to build a decent gaming right for $500. Oblivion needs a heck of a system to play well (you should still be able to run it - just not at ultra high settings)

I would take that system you linked to and try and come up with a parts list/pricing as individual parts...there was just a huge drop in AMD CPU prices yesterday - so that will definitely help.

Also, I hope you are not set on a 256MB video card...you will probably ahve to do with a 128MB card - and avoid any Turbocache or Hypermemory cards - those just steal system memory...
